Pilar Bougas (May 26, 1929 – February 23, 2025), known professionally as Pilar Del Rey, was an American actress whose career spanned from the late 1940s until 1990. She was best known for portraying Mrs. Obregón in the 1956 epic film Giant.[1]

Background
Del Rey was born in Fort Worth, Texas, on May 26, 1929. She died in Los Angeles, California, on February 23, 2025, at the age of 95.[1]
Career
Pilar Del Rey appeared in several Westerns early in her career. Her first credited role was Marguarita in The Kid from Texas (1950).[2] This was followed by Siege at Red River in 1954.[3] In 1956 she appeared as Mrs. Obregón in Giant, alongside James Dean.[1][4] She also appeared in the Western television series The Adventures of Kit Carson[5] and the radio drama Maria Elena.[6] A character actress, her credits include various Mexican and Spanish female characters.[7]
